Диаграмма Chartbar

Это один из режимов компонента Таблица.
Пример работы компонента - учет загрузки ресурсов.


Позволяет вывести таблицу в виде chartbar-полос. 


Для показа chartbar, необходимо сделать следующее: 
  1. Создать таблицу с колонками id (PK),title, ord. Это статусы элементов, выводятся наверху канбан доски. 
  2. В SELECT 1 в GetItems выбрать эту таблицу
    	declare   @result TABLE (id nvarchar(128), title nvarchar(256), ord int)
    
    	insert into @result
        select  'sun' id, 'sum 1' title, 1 ord
        union
        select  'mon' id, 'mon 1' title, 2 ord
        union
        select  'tue' id, 'tue 1' title, 3 ord
        union
        select  'wed' id, 'wed 1' title, 4 ord
        union
        select  'thu' id, 'thu 1' title, 5 ord
        union
        select  'fri' id, 'fri 1' title, 6 ord
        union
        select  'sat' id, 'sat 1' title, 7 ord
    
    
        select * from @result
    	order by ord
  3. В SELECT 3 в GetItems указать тип вывода viewType='chartbar'
  4. В SELECT 4 в GetItems (вместо данных футера) выводим данные по полосам (именно с такой моделью данных). 
    -- SELECT 4 Имена полей в точности должны быть такими как в примере
        select '123' itemID, 'tue~' [from], 'wed' [to], 'Задача 1' [title], 'Подпись по названием' [desc], '123' cssClass, '#b03532' color
        union
        select '123' itemID, 'wed' [from], 'wed' [to], 'Задача 2' [title], '' [desc], '123' cssClass, '#33a8a5' color
        union
        select '123' itemID, 'sun' [from], 'tue' [to], 'Задача 3' [title], '' [desc], '123' cssClass, '#30997a' color
        union
        select '123' itemID, 'tue~' [from], 'thu' [to], 'Задача 4' [title], '' [desc], '123' cssClass, '#6a478f' color
       

    Примечание:
    1. Если необходимо добавлять форму, то внедряем верстку сниппета в поле title. 
    2. Для полей указывайте именно формат cssClass(а не CssClass) в SELECT 4. 
    3. Все поля в SELECT 4 - строковые (в том числе и itemID). 
Примечание